import { route } from "@spacebar/api";
import { Ban, DiscordApiErrors, GuildBanAddEvent, GuildBanRemoveEvent, Member, User, emitEvent } from "@spacebar/util";
import { Request, Response, Router } from "express";
import { HTTPError } from "lambert-server";
import { BanCreateSchema, BanRegistrySchema, GuildBanResponse, GuildBansResponse, PublicUser } from "@spacebar/schemas";
const router: Router = Router({ mergeParams: true });
/* TODO: Deleting the secrets is just a temporary go-around. Views should be implemented for both safety and better handling. */
router.get(
"/",
route({
permission: "BAN_MEMBERS",
responses: {
200: {
body: "GuildBansResponse",
},
403: {
body: "APIErrorResponse",
},
},
}),
async (req: Request, res: Response) => {
const { guild_id } = req.params as { [key: string]: string };
let bans = await Ban.find({ where: { guild_id: guild_id } });
const promisesToAwait: Promise<PublicUser>[] = [];
const bansObj: GuildBansResponse = [];
bans = bans.filter((ban) => ban.user_id !== ban.executor_id); // pretend self-bans don't exist to prevent victim chasing
bans.forEach((ban) => {
promisesToAwait.push(User.getPublicUser(ban.user_id));
});
const bannedUsers = await Promise.all(promisesToAwait);
bans.forEach((ban, index) => {
const user = bannedUsers[index];
bansObj.push({
reason: ban.reason ?? null,
user: {
username: user.username,
discriminator: user.discriminator,
id: user.id,
avatar: user.avatar ?? null,
public_flags: user.public_flags,
},
});
});
return res.json(bansObj);
},
);
router.get(
"/search",
route({
permission: "BAN_MEMBERS",
query: {
query: {
type: "string",
description: "Query to match username(s) and display name(s) against (1-32 characters)",
required: true,
},
limit: {
type: "number",
description: "Max number of members to return (1-10, default 10)",
required: false,
},
},
responses: {
200: {
body: "GuildBansResponse",
},
403: {
body: "APIErrorResponse",
},
},
}),
async (req: Request, res: Response) => {
const { guild_id } = req.params as { [key: string]: string };
const limit = Number(req.query.limit) || 10;
if (limit > 10 || limit < 1) throw new HTTPError("Limit must be between 1 and 10");
const query = String(req.query.query);
if (!query || query.trim().length === 0 || query.length > 32) {
throw new HTTPError("The query must be between 1 and 32 characters in length");
}
let bans = await Ban.createQueryBuilder("ban")
.leftJoinAndSelect("ban.user", "user")
.where("ban.guild_id = :guildId", { guildId: guild_id })
.andWhere("user.username LIKE :userName", {
userName: `%${query}%`,
})
.limit(limit)
.getMany();
bans = bans.filter((ban) => ban.user_id !== ban.executor_id); // pretend self-bans don't exist to prevent victim chasing
const bansObj: GuildBansResponse = bans.map((ban) => {
const user = ban.user;
return {
reason: ban.reason ?? null,
user: {
username: user.username,
discriminator: user.discriminator,
id: user.id,
avatar: user.avatar ?? null,
public_flags: user.public_flags,
},
};
});
return res.json(bansObj);
},
);
router.get(
"/:user_id",
route({
permission: "BAN_MEMBERS",
responses: {
200: {
body: "GuildBanResponse",
},
403: {
body: "APIErrorResponse",
},
404: {
body: "APIErrorResponse",
},
},
}),
async (req: Request, res: Response) => {
const { guild_id, user_id } = req.params as { [key: string]: string };
const ban = (await Ban.findOneOrFail({
where: { guild_id: guild_id, user_id: user_id },
})) as BanRegistrySchema;
if (ban.user_id === ban.executor_id) throw DiscordApiErrors.UNKNOWN_BAN;
// pretend self-bans don't exist to prevent victim chasing
const user = await User.getPublicUser(ban.user_id);
const banInfo: GuildBanResponse = {
user: {
username: user.username,
discriminator: user.discriminator,
id: user.id,
avatar: user.avatar ?? null,
public_flags: user.public_flags,
},
reason: ban.reason ?? null,
};
return res.json(banInfo);
},
);
router.put(
"/:user_id",
route({
requestBody: "BanCreateSchema",
permission: "BAN_MEMBERS",
responses: {
204: {},
400: {
body: "APIErrorResponse",
},
403: {
body: "APIErrorResponse",
},
},
}),
async (req: Request, res: Response) => {
const { guild_id } = req.params as { [key: string]: string };
const banned_user_id = req.params.user_id as string;
const opts = req.body as BanCreateSchema;
let deleteMessagesMs = opts.delete_message_days
? (opts.delete_message_days as number) * 86400000
: opts.delete_message_seconds
? (opts.delete_message_seconds as number) * 1000
: 0;
if (deleteMessagesMs < 0) deleteMessagesMs = 0;
if (req.user_id === banned_user_id && banned_user_id === req.permission?.cache.guild?.owner_id)
throw new HTTPError("You are the guild owner, hence can't ban yourself", 403);
if (req.permission?.cache.guild?.owner_id === banned_user_id) throw new HTTPError("You can't ban the owner", 400);
const existingBan = await Ban.findOne({
where: { guild_id: guild_id, user_id: banned_user_id },
});
// Bans on already banned users are silently ignored
if (existingBan) return res.status(204).send();
const banned_user = await User.getPublicUser(banned_user_id);
const ban = Ban.create({
user_id: banned_user_id,
guild_id: guild_id,
executor_id: req.user_id,
reason: req.body.reason, // || otherwise empty
});
await Promise.all([
Member.removeFromGuild(banned_user_id, guild_id),
ban.save(),
emitEvent({
event: "GUILD_BAN_ADD",
data: {
guild_id: guild_id,
user: banned_user,
delete_message_secs: Math.floor(deleteMessagesMs / 1000),
},
guild_id: guild_id,
} satisfies GuildBanAddEvent),
]);
return res.status(204).send();
},
);
router.delete(
"/:user_id",
route({
permission: "BAN_MEMBERS",
responses: {
204: {},
403: {
body: "APIErrorResponse",
},
404: {
body: "APIErrorResponse",
},
},
}),
async (req: Request, res: Response) => {
const { guild_id, user_id } = req.params as { [key: string]: string };
await Ban.findOneOrFail({
where: { guild_id: guild_id, user_id: user_id },
});
const banned_user = await User.getPublicUser(user_id);
await Promise.all([
Ban.delete({
user_id: user_id,
guild_id,
}),
emitEvent({
event: "GUILD_BAN_REMOVE",
data: {
guild_id,
user: banned_user,
},
guild_id,
} satisfies GuildBanRemoveEvent),
]);
return res.status(204).send();
},
);
export default router;
